Episode 1: Ram Van Gaman Path | Exploring Shringverpur Dham
Welcome to the first episode of our series "Ram Van Gaman Path," where we visit significant places traversed by Lord Shri Ram, Lakshman ji, and Sita ji during their 14-year exile. In this episode, we explore Shringverpur Dham, located 35 to 40 km from Prayagraj (formerly Allahabad).
Highlights of This Episode:
Ramghat: The starting point of Shri Ram's journey into the forest, where he met his childhood friend Nishadraj ji and where Kevat helped him cross the River Ganga.
Ram Shayan Ashram: Featuring Sheesham trees under which Shri Ram, Lakshman ji, and Mata Sita ji spent a night before crossing the Ganga.
Sita Kund: The place where Mata Sita offered her prayers.
Shringi Rishi Ashram Temple: A temple dedicated to Shringi Rishi, Devi Shanta, and Shitla Mata.
NishadRaj ka Quilla: An archaeological site with historical significance.
About Shringverpur Dham: Shringverpur is renowned for its mythological significance as the kingdom of Nishadraj. It's a pivotal location in the Ramayana, where Lord Rama began his journey towards the forest and was aided by his friend Nishadraj and the boatman Kevat.
